Output 43c6081876e951c5a5917cd66b8718da7806a374310fcaa812a54335251cb1bc:1

value
665351
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69539b0efb2bbd3a57685c60571ec70878d21736 OP_EQUALVERIFY OP_CHECKSIG
address
1Abv7AjmJDtbTGVBZfrVetTadY2EM7Gqte
transaction
43c6081876e951c5a5917cd66b8718da7806a374310fcaa812a54335251cb1bc
spent
true